7 Episodes 2011 - 2011
Episode 1
Mon, Aug 8, 2011 180 mins
Season 2 premiere: Eighteen onetime "Bachelor" and "Bachelorette" contestants (estranged 2010 "Bachelor" couple Jake Pavelka and Vienna Girardi among them) move into the franchise's Malibu mansion to vie for a cash prize and, perhaps, to find romance. The challenge in the opener: "The Hook Up." Couples suspended 10 feet above ground must cling to each other, with the couple clinging the longest being spared from facing elimination, a fate that will befall one guy and one gal.
Episode 2
Mon, Aug 15, 2011 120 mins
The challenge: "Target on My Back." Gals throw paint-soaked balls at guys they want thrown out of the Bachelor Pad (and vice versa). Kasey and Vienna target Jake. The losers face elimination while the winners go on three-on-one dates, either to a haunted hospital or a night on a yacht.
Episode 3
Mon, Aug 22, 2011 120 mins
As the guys and gals face a synchronized-swimming challenge, Jake finds (and Kasey and Vienna lose) allies. Meanwhile, Melissa gets mad at Blake, and the formerly affianced Michael and Holly share what might be a defining moment in their relationship.
Episode 4
Mon, Aug 29, 2011 121 mins
The housemates plot against the power couple, while one of the new guys emerges as the least popular person in the pad. Also: everyone takes part in a kissing challenge to determine who has the best lips.
Episode 5
Mon, Sep 5, 2011 120 mins
The surviving contestants must team up and compete as couples, beginning with a Nearly Wed Game challenge, in which they are tested on how well they know each other.
Episode 6
Mon, Sep 12, 2011 60 mins
The Season 2 finale begins in Las Vegas, where the four remaining couples—Vienna and Kasey, Michelle and Graham, Ella and Kirk, and Holly and Michael—have just 24 hours to master a Cirque du Soleil routine that takes place on a wall 100 feet in the air. Judges Trista Sutter, Jason Mesnick and Ali Fedotowsky eliminate one couple, and the winning couple then get to choose the other couple that will join them in the finals.
Episode 7
Mon, Sep 12, 2011 120 mins
The Season 2 finale concludes back in L.A., where the couple who won the Cirque du Soleil challenge pick the couple they'll go up against in the final vote. The voters: the eliminated housemates. The prize for the winners: $250,000. Also: 2012 "Bachelor" Ben Flajnik is introduced.
